The Pain Aspect: Is Lasik Surgical Treatment Actually Excruciating?
Is Lasik surgical procedure truly as painful as some individuals state? The fact is, the majority of patients experience minimal pain during the treatment.
Surgeons utilize numbing eye drops, so you will not feel any type of acute pain. You may see stress or an experience of drawing, but it's typically brief. The laser itself functions swiftly-- typically in just a couple of mins per eye-- so any kind of experiences you really feel pass swiftly.
Later, you might experience some moderate discomfort, like a sandy sensation or minor inflammation, yet this generally discolors within a couple of hours. Your physician will certainly provide assistance on managing any kind of discomfort post-surgery.
Recognizing Recuperation: For How Long Does It Actually Take?
For how long does it require to completely recoup from Lasik surgical procedure? Most individuals observe enhanced vision within a day, yet full healing can take about 3 to 6 months.
In the very first few days, you may experience some dry skin, glare, or halos around lights, yet these signs usually fade promptly. Best Place To Get LASIK 'll have follow-up appointments to ensure your eyes are healing properly.
It's necessary to follow your medical professional's post-operative care instructions, which might consist of making use of recommended eye drops and preventing arduous tasks.

Candidateship Confusion: Who Is a Good Prospect for Lasik?
After recognizing the recuperation process, it's important to consider whether you're an appropriate prospect for Lasik surgical treatment.
Usually, good candidates are at least 18 years old and have steady vision for a minimum of a year. If you're nearsighted, farsighted, or have astigmatism, you could certify.
Nonetheless, certain problems like serious completely dry eyes, glaucoma, or corneal illness can invalidate you. You must also avoid Lasik if you're pregnant or nursing, as hormonal changes can affect your vision.
A complete eye exam with a qualified specialist will certainly assist establish your eligibility.
